Christian Andolf
69ed852fc4
fix: only phrasing content is allowed inside buttons meaning no div or p elements, these are now replaced by span
2024-10-28 15:35:56 +01:00
Erik Tiekstra
676b763e67
fix(SW-272): now closing on click outside and also closing the mobile menu when changing to screensizes larger than mobile
2024-10-07 14:04:28 +02:00
Bianca Widstam
2e26506b39
Merged in feat/SW-517-language-switcher-dismiss (pull request #626 )
...
Feat/SW-517 language switcher dismiss
* feat(SW-517): Close language switcher when clicking outside
* feat(SW-517): Close language switcher on selection
* feat(SW-517): Fix mobile header
Approved-by: Niclas Edenvin
Approved-by: Linus Flood
2024-10-01 08:58:19 +00:00
Erik Tiekstra
3f7b8a524e
feat(SW-272) link style changes
2024-09-27 09:34:33 +02:00
Pontus Dreij
efb8d278cd
fix(sw-398): moved logic for disable scroll in mobile and fixed issue that page is scrolling when toggling languageswitcher
2024-09-18 12:41:40 +02:00
Pontus Dreij
d555447467
fix(SW-378): remove unused css
2024-09-13 16:46:09 +02:00
Pontus Dreij
a8cef1c6c5
feat(SW-378): Updated styling
2024-09-13 09:39:45 +02:00
Pontus Dreij
ca4521e4a1
feat(SW-378): Added close button to footer language switcher and made it slide up from below
2024-09-13 09:37:00 +02:00
Pontus Dreij
b01fca97ba
feat(SW-187): added immer and refactor dropdown a bit
2024-09-11 14:17:44 +02:00
Pontus Dreij
2734af5f3f
feat(sw-187): Refactor dropdown to keep more logic in main-menu.ts
2024-09-11 11:41:26 +02:00
Pontus Dreij
76c7cfa6f0
feat(SW-187): Fixed toggling issue
2024-09-11 10:18:39 +02:00
Pontus Dreij
ae868ee8cd
feat(SW-187): fixed bug where languageswitcher opened mobile menu
2024-09-09 15:34:47 +02:00
Pontus Dreij
07eb0401bb
feat(SW-187): simplify dropdown menu
2024-09-09 14:58:22 +02:00
Pontus Dreij
6d55ee7595
feat(SW-187): Fixed LanguageSwitcher for footer
2024-09-06 13:56:23 +02:00
Erik Tiekstra
84985737b6
fix(SW-184): using more variables and removed variants from navigation menu after PR
2024-09-03 13:26:16 +02:00
Erik Tiekstra
e03e954387
fix(SW-184): added some variables and other small fixes related to comments on PR
2024-09-03 13:26:15 +02:00
Erik Tiekstra
d1a2175804
chore: cleanup
2024-09-03 13:26:15 +02:00
Erik Tiekstra
f1242e69e3
fix(SW-184): added translations
2024-09-03 13:26:15 +02:00
Erik Tiekstra
a02dcd3428
fix(SW-184): fixed implementation of useTrapFocus
2024-09-03 13:26:15 +02:00
Erik Tiekstra
bdec054ecd
feat(SW-184): my pages menu mobile/desktop functionality
2024-09-03 13:26:15 +02:00
Erik Tiekstra
7ef7b4a544
feat(SW-184): language switcher mobile/desktop functionality
2024-09-03 13:26:15 +02:00
Erik Tiekstra
a2e2cf575e
feat(SW-184): implementing mobile design
2024-09-03 13:26:15 +02:00